Kanji Detail for 亙 - "to span, to cross"

  • Meaning

    亙 means "to span, to cross."

    1. To cross - To traverse.

    2. To span - To extend from end to end; to continue.

  • Dictionary Citations

    The meaning above is based on the following sources:

    KANJIDIC2 A comprehensive Japanese-English kanji dictionary

    range; reach; extend; cover

    Unihan Unicode Han Database for CJK characters

    extend across, through; from

    CC-CEDICT A Chinese-English dictionary

    extending all the way across; running all the way through

    Make Me a Hanzi Open-source Chinese character data

    through; to extend across; to, from

    XSZD Xuéshēng Zìdiǎn (學生字典) - Student's Dictionary

    Throughout; spanning. Meaning something extends from this end all the way to that end.
